Abstract

A communication relay apparatus wherein the error rate characteristic of a relay destination is improved to raise the throughput, while reducing the given interference power to prevent the reduction of the throughput of the whole communication system. In the apparatus, a signal addressed to a base station is received (ST 1010 ), and a decoding process and other processes are performed (ST 1020 ). A bit error determination is performed (ST 1030 ), and if there is no bit error, a reproduction/relay process (ST 1050 ) is performed. If there is any bit error, a threshold-based determination of reception quality is performed for each of subcarriers (ST 1120 - 1130 ). If the reception quality is greater than a threshold value, the corresponding subcarrier is outputted (ST 1140 ); otherwise, the corresponding subcarrier is not relayed (ST 1150 ). A signal, which has been subjected to either process, is transmitted (ST 1060 ).

Claims (35)

1. A communication relay apparatus, comprising:

a first determining section that determines a first received quality of a whole of a received signal comprising a plurality of elements;

a first relay section that relays the whole of the received signal according to a first determination result of the first determining section;

a second determining section that determines a second received quality of the received signal per element; and

a second relay section that relays a specific element of the received signal according to a second determination result of the second determining section, wherein:

when the first received quality is equal to or higher than a first predetermined level, the first relay section determines the received signal as a relay target; and

the second relay section determines, as the relay target, an element out of the received signal which is not the relay target of the first relay section, the element having the second received quality equal to or higher than a second predetermined level.

2. The communication relay ap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ein:

the first relay section performs a regenerative relay of decoding, re-encoding and relaying the received signal; and

the second relay section performs a non-regenerative relay of power-amplifying and relaying the received signal.

3. The communication relay ap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ein:

the first determining section uses, as the first received quality, a presence or an absence of one of a bit error and a packet error;

the first relay section determines, as the relay target, the received signal which does not have the bit error or the packet error;

the second determining section uses, as the second received quality, one of a signal to interference ratio, a signal to interference and noise ratio, a carrier to interference ratio, and a carrier to interference and noise ratio; and

the second relay section determines, as the relay target, the element having the second received quality equal to or higher than a threshold value.

4. The communication relay apparatus according to claim 3 , wherein the threshold value is set based on a required bit error rate or a required packet error rate when error correction coding is performed and static characteristics are exhibited.

5. The communication relay apparatus according to claim 4 , wherein:

the threshold value includes an offset; and

the offset is set based on a number of communication relay apparatuses that actually perform a relay.

6. The communication relay apparatus according to claim 3 , wherein:

the second determining section further compares the element, having the second received quality equal to or higher than the threshold value, with a hard decision threshold value; and

the second relay section performs a hard decision and a relay on the element having the second received quality equal to or higher than the hard decision threshold value.

7. The communication relay apparatus according to claim 6 , wherein the hard decision threshold value is set based on a required bit error rate or a required packet error rate when error correction coding is not performed and static characteristics are exhibited.

8. The communication relay ap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the second relay section sets transmission power of the specific element higher when the second received quality of the element is poorer.

9. The communication relay ap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the second relay section limits the relay target according to a type of data that is mapped on the element, out of the element having the second received quality equal to or higher than the second predetermined level.

10. The communication relay ap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ein one of subchannels, subcarriers, substreams, channels corresponding to spreading codes, time frames, and time slots is used as the element.

11. A communication terminal apparatus comprising the communication relay apparatus according to claim 1 .

12. A base station apparatus comprising the communication relay apparatus according to claim 1 .

13. A communication relay method, comprising:

determining by a relay apparatus a first received quality of a whole of a received signal comprising a plurality of elements;

relaying the whole of the received signal according to a result of the first received quality determination;

determining a second received quality of the received signal per element;

relaying a specific element of the received signal according to a result of the second received quality determination;

determining as a relay target the received signal when the first received quality is equal to or higher than a first predetermined level; and

determining as the relay target an element out of the received signal which is not the relay target, the element having the second received quality equal to or higher than a second predetermined level.
